Solution

To solve the equation: \[ 5(2z - 9) = -35 \] **Step 1: Distribute the 5 on the left side** \[ 5 \times 2z - 5 \times 9 = -35 \] \[ 10z - 45 = -35 \] **Step 2: Add 45 to both sides to isolate the term with \( z \)** \[ 10z - 45 + 45 = -35 + 45 \] \[ 10z = 10 \] **Step 3: Divide both sides by 10 to solve for \( z \)** \[ \frac{10z}{10} = \frac{10}{10} \] \[ z = 1 \] **Solution:** \( z = 1 \)

To solve the equation \( 5(2z - 9) = -35 \), start by dividing both sides by 5: \[ 2z - 9 = -7 \] Next, add 9 to both sides: \[ 2z = 2 \] Now, divide by 2: \[ z = 1 \] The solution to the equation is \( z = 1 \).
